This position is a virtual, contract 1099 position that is open to Paralegals in the United States only. Please do not apply if you are not living in the United States as your resume will not be reviewed or considered.
The ideal candidates must have experience in the areas of 1) Probate Administration; and 2) Probate Litigation. Candidates must have experience with Florida State Law and Procedure. South Florida jurisdictions a huge plus. Florida resident preferred but not required if proof of Florida-based experience can be shown. Must reside in the EST (Eastern) Time Zone.
Candidates should be proficient in the drafting probate admi nistration documents ( drafting petitions, coordinating with other parties, etc.) , drafting probate litigation documents including petitions, discovery, subpoenas, notices, etc., collection and organization of documents, forms and information from various cases at the firm, meeting with and assisting clients via phone, Zoom or Google Meet, obtaini ng necessary records & reports, drafting pleadings and discovery, calendaring deadlines on a firm calendar, etc. Candidates should feel comfortable relaying messages between various groups and keeping all documents important to the cases organized in an online database.
The perfect candidates are proactive, detailed-oriented, team players with the ability to work well independently and maintain a high level of attention to all details and timeliness of deadlines.

Responsibilities
- Draft probate administration and litigation documents, obtain documents and records from clients and state and local agencies, be familiar with all aspects of probate law and procedure in the State of Florida.
- Review and edit legal documents pertaining to probate administration and litigation in the State of Florida.
- E-Filing, propounding and answering discovery, propounding subpoenas.
- Calendaring deadlines, scheduling of hearings, depositions, etc.
- Meeting with clients via phone or zoom when necessary.
- Create and maintain electronic case files.
- Facilitate the meeting of attorney deadlines by keeping organized schedules and providing timely reminders.
- Conduct legal research.
- Communication with clients, attorneys, opposing counsels, judicial offices, etc.
